Dna large molecule that contains genes. Genes small segments of dna that contain information for producing proteins. Alleles different forms of a gene. Dominant alleles alleles that show their effect even if there is only one for that trait in the pair. Recessive alleles alleles that show their effects only when both alleles are the same. Behavioral genetics scientific study of the role of heredity in behavior. Relationship between specific genes and behavior is complex. Most specific behaviors derive from dozens/hundreds of genes. Studying twins and adoptees, behavioral genetics may disentangle the contributions of heredity and environment that influence behavior. Environment influences how and when genes affect behavior. Central nervous system part of the nervous system that comprises the brain and spinal cord. Sympathetic nervous system branch of the autonomic nervous system that activates bodily systems in times of emergencies.
